As Plane Types, there are Dynamic Planes and Static Planes. The following will explain how to toggle the Plane Type.
There are the following methods for changing the Type.
- Executing from the Menu
- Executing from the Property Window
- Executing from the Plane Screen
The following will explain how to toggle the Plane Type from the menu ("Dynamic Plane => Static Plane" or "Static Plane => Dynamic Plane"). |
(1) |
Right Click => Select [Toggle Plane Type]. |

The Plane Type will be toggled. |

The following will explain how to toggle the Plane Type from Property ("Dynamic Plane => Static Plane" or "Static Plane => Dynamic Plane"). |
(1) |
Toggle "Plane Type" in the Property Window. |

The following will explain how to toggle the Plane Type from the Plane screen ("Dynamic Plane => Static Plane" or "Static Plane => Dynamic Plane"). |
(1) |
Double-click a plane. |

(2) |
Change the Plane Type. |
(3) |
Click "OK". |
